Shotgun wedding for Diamond, Conexant

by - source: Tom's Hardware

Diamond Multimedia Systems Inc. is licensing its Shotgun modem-bonding technology to Conexant Systems Inc., a maker of semiconductor equipment for communications products.

Shotgun technology allows the data streams of two modems to work together over two ordinary phone lines. With this technology, users can experience Internet connection speeds of up to 112 kbps, with the capability to release one phone line for voice calls while maintaining the Internet connection on the other.

Currently, Shotgun technology is supported in over 2,000 cities nationwide. The technology is also available in the Diamond SupraSonic II modem, as well as the entire line of SupraExpress 56K V.90 modems.
